Many people are surprised to discover that even a small amount of drugs can create very large legal problems in Virginia, because there is no specific amount of drugs that qualifies as a case of possession with intent to distribute. The police can charge the people who are present with possession with intent to distribute a controlled substance based on the circumstances and the evidence at the scene such as cash, baggies, packaging and/or scales.
